GDOT Wants Online Feedback on S.R. 20 Improvements
The state agency has launched an online survey where residents can share ideas on how to improve Highway 20 between Canton and Cumming.
The Georgia Department of Transportation wants commuters to take to the Internet to give feedback on what should be done to improve S.R. 20 between Canton and Cumming.
The state agency has launched a survey motorists can take between now and July 15. The survey can be taken at http://sr20.metroquest.com/.
"State Route 20 has exceeded its capacity and multiple improvements are needed to improve safety and mobility in Cherokee and Forsyth counties," the agency said in a news release.
The agency is exploring options on much needed improvements on the highway between Interstate 575 in Canton and S.R. 400 in Cumming.
GDOT in May held two public input meetings — one in Cumming and another in Ball Ground — in which GDOT staff members discussed with residents what could be placed on the table as a way to improve the highway.
